They performed 100 PPV for treating primary RRD capability to visualize within the attention, this encouraging technology may enhance what we do as surgeons.Objectives Previous studies have examined the hyperlink between discrimination and wellness in lesbian, gay, bisexual, and/or transgender (LGBT) people. The purpose of this study was to analyze if health-promoting variables, like social support systems, might disrupt this connection. Method Participants had been 2,560 LGBT older adults which reported regarding the structure of their social networking, standard of discrimination, anxiety, and health/well-being. Outcomes Moderated mediation outcomes indicated that social networking size disrupted the associations between discrimination, anxiety, and health effects when social networking sites were (a) bigger and (b) comprised of LGBT individuals (however straight people), irrespective of age. Discussion heavier social support systems that include fellow LGBT people helped buffer experiences of anxiety and discrimination on health outcomes among LGBT older grownups. Information originated from the 2016 Kids' Inpatient Database for the medical Cost Utilization Project. A complete of 6537 young ones elderly less then 12 months with a diagnosis of LM (International Classification of Diseases, tenth Revision, code Q31.5) were identified 2212 neonates and 4325 non-neonates. Neonates had an increased mortality price, 1.31% versus 0.72% in older babies, had more diagnoses (median 9 vs 7) and treatments (suggest 85.24 vs 21.83), longer amount of stay (median 10 vs 4 days), and higher total costs (median US$65 722 vs US$25 582). An overall total of 23.3per cent of neonates produced through the admission and clinically determined to have LM had withstood laryngoscopy. Second airway lesions had been present in 12.33% of neonates and 15.77% of older babies. It appears that neonates are increasingly being released with an analysis of LM without laryngoscopy. In inclusion, there is broad variation in institutional protocols when it comes to management of IV infiltrations. Through retrospective review, we try to delineate complications and effects, and recommend an algorithm for the handling of these injuries. Methods We performed a retrospective article on all patients who'd an IV infiltration at a tertiary care center's inpatient and outpatient services between January 1, 2016, and December 31, 2018. Leads to all, 479 clients with 495 infiltrations had been included, with a mean age of 36.7 years. The top of extremity had been involved in 89.6per cent of occasions. Of the many events, 8.6% resulted in a superficial soft structure infection, 3.2% resulted in necrosis or eschar formation, and 1.9% generated ulceration or full-thickness injury formation. There were zero instances of compartment syndrome. Just 5.1% resulted in any long-term problems; none resulted in a functional defect of this extremity. Customers with vascular condition did not experience worse outcomes compared to healthier individuals.
